Relaxed cycling through the Lake District

Scenic and cultural highlights as far as the eye can see – the lake district in Austria near the world-famous Mozart city of Salzburg offers countless possibilities. This tour is based in one hotel. This means that you have accommodation as a base for the entire trip and take day drips from there.

First, you will cycle on beautifully landscaped ways to the monastery Michaelbeuern. In the restaurant Stiftskellnerei you can enjoy the famous Augustinerbräu beer under old chestnut trees. On your way back, you will cycle between green meadows, through the rural countryside of the Alpine foothills to your hotel at Lake Obertrum.

Starting at Lake Obertrum, you will cycle to Lake Wallersee. From Seekirchen (castle Seeburg) you will continue your trip on the Wallersee cycle path to the well-known farm Gut Aiderbichl (admission fee included in the tour package price!). From there, you will cycle at the foot of mount Tannberg to Schleedorf (village museum with cheese factory), down to Lake Mattsee, and back to your hotel.

Today, you will cycle via the Egelseen lakes and through the Tiefsteinklamm gorge to Lake Wallersee. After passing the so-called Finsterloch you will have time for a lunch break with a hearty snack (included in the tour package price!). Afterwards, you will continue your tour to Lake Irrsee and Lake Mondsee and to the town of the same name – Mondsee – with its old castle and historic church. At the end of your day, you will be taken back to your hotel.

The day starts with a short transfer to Salzburg. On the Salzach riverside walk you will leisurely cycle to Oberndorf, the birthplace of the famous Christmas carol “Silent Night”. On your way back to the Trumer Seen lakes, you can either cycle over or around Mount Haunsberg.

The train will take you to Hallein. In the Celtic town it is worth a visit to the Celtic museum or the salt mine. Then you will cycle along the Salzach river and via the Hellbrunn castle with its world-famous fountains to Salzburg. Later, you will return along the Fischbach rivers and Mattig to Seeham.

Level

Occasional cyclists

You prefer flat terrain, but you won’t be put off by the occasional hill. There has to be the right mix of breaks, nature and culture. You enjoy exercise and bring some stamina and cycling experience to the table.

Topography 

Slightly hilly, but with long flat sections in between.

Road conditions

You will mostly ride on cycle paths and farm roads as well as low-traffic side roads.

Route-finding & navigation

You will navigate by yourself using maps and/or GPS data.

Fancy a break from cycling?

On a location-based tour, you can simply choose to skip a day's cycling if a stage seems too difficult for you.
